在管理学中,需求文档是制定项目或产品规划的基石之一。它们包括需求说明书(SRS)、业务需求文档(BRD)、市场需求文档(MRD)以及功能需求文档(FRD)。其中,需求说明书(SRS)的作用尤为关键,因为它详细描述了产品必须满足的具体功能和非功能需求,为项目开发提供了明确的指导。
一、需求说明书(SRS)
需求说明书(SRS)是一份详细描述产品功能和约束条件的文档。它为产品开发团队提供了明确的技术需求指导,确保产品开发过程中的每一步都能满足最终用户的需求。
-
明确性与可测试性:SRS的一个关键特点是其需求的明确性和可测试性。需求必须清晰无误地表述,以便开发人员理解并据此进行设计与编码。同时,需求的表述应当具有可测试性,即能够通过测试验证需求是否得到满足。
-
用户和系统需求的全面覆盖:SRS不仅包括用户界面和功能需求,还应覆盖系统性能、数据、安全性以及其他非功能需求。这确保了产品在设计和实现时能全面满足用户和系统的需求。
二、业务需求文档(BRD)
业务需求文档(BRD)聚焦于业务目标和需求,它描述了项目或产品背后的业务动机和目标,以及为达成这些目标所需满足的业务条件和需求。
-
业务目标的阐述:BRD清晰地定义了项目或产品的业务目标,这有助于确保所有参与者对项目的最终目标有共同的理解。
-
业务流程和需求:BRD详细描述了现有的业务流程以及新系统需要满足的业务需求。这包括对现状的评估和对未来状态的预期,为产品或系统的设计提供了业务层面的指导。
三、市场需求文档(MRD)
市场需求文档(MRD)从市场的角度出发,确定产品需满足的市场需求、目标客户群体以及竞争优势。
-
市场细分与目标客户:MRD通过市场细分来确定目标客户群体,这有助于产品团队更好地理解目标市场并制定相应的产品策略。
-
竞争分析和定位:MRD包括对竞争对手的分析以及产品的市场定位。这不仅有助于识别市场机会,还能为产品提供独特的竞争优势。
四、功能需求文档(FRD)
功能需求文档(FRD)详细说明了产品的功能需求,包括系统如何响应特定的用户输入以及如何执行特定的任务。
-
功能的详细描述:FRD中的每个功能都需要有详细的描述,包括功能的目的、输入、输出以及其他相关的功能需求。
-
优先级与依赖关系:FRD还需确定各功能需求的优先级和依赖关系,这对于项目的规划和阶段性实施至关重要。
总之,需求文档在项目和产品管理中发挥着至关重要的作用。它们不仅帮助团队明确目标和预期成果,还指导项目的实施和控制。通过详细的需求分析和文档编制,可以大大提高项目成功的可能性,并确保最终产品能够满足用户和市场的需求。
相关问答FAQs:
什么是管理学中的需求文档?
管理学中的需求文档是指在项目管理和业务分析中使用的一种文档,用于记录和明确项目或业务的需求和目标。
需求文档在管理学中有什么作用?
需求文档在管理学中起到明确和共享项目或业务需求的作用。它可以帮助团队成员理解和对齐需求,确保项目或业务的目标与利益相关者的期望一致。
管理学中的需求文档都包含哪些内容?
管理学中的需求文档通常包含以下内容:项目或业务的背景和目的、利益相关者的需求和期望、功能和非功能需求、系统或流程的描述、用户故事、使用案例、界面设计、数据模型等。
如何编写一个有效的管理学需求文档?
要编写一个有效的管理学需求文档,可以采取以下步骤:
1.明确项目或业务的背景和目的,确保文档的上下文清晰。
2.收集并整理利益相关者的需求和期望,确保包含全面而准确的信息。
3.明确功能和非功能需求,确保对项目或业务的要求清楚明确。
4.使用用户故事或使用案例来描述系统或流程,帮助读者更好地理解需求。
5.结合界面设计和数据模型,以图形化的方式呈现需求,提高可视化效果。
6.定期与团队成员和利益相关者进行沟通和协作,确保需求文档的准确性和更新。
管理学中的需求文档与其他学科有什么区别?
管理学中的需求文档与其他学科的需求文档有一些区别。管理学中的需求文档更加注重项目管理和业务分析的角度,关注利益相关者的需求和期望,以及项目或业务的目标和利益。而其他学科的需求文档可能更加专注于技术规范和系统设计等方面。因此,在编写管理学中的需求文档时,需要更加注重对利益相关者需求的理解和描述。